I'm looking for a drip tray for the Dometic fridge it's the tray that mounts under the metal condensate fins inside the fridge and has a hole on the left to drain out the back.
Also, I just noticed a crack on the stationary upper glass on the driver side window. How hard are they to replace and any one know of a source?

It is quite a job. You have to take out the whole window and take it apart. The good parts is that it gives you the chance to to reseal it so you get a window that does not let rain in
Window panes only 2hand

As Apple mentioned, the only source is from a "Parts Coach". The glass curves in 3 dimensions and no one is making new ones.
I would call JmK, Jim Bounds, or Jeff Sirium. Other well know GMC suppliers may also have this glass.
